My contemporary botanical works explore the visual intersection and immersion between reality and technology, and the resulting responses to the real and the reconstructed.

They explore the complex repetitive geometric structures of iconic plants and the boundaries of traditional Australian botanical art.

By referencing flora, it is a creative approach rooted deep in experience as a visual artist and horticulturist.
Represented here is Banksia menziesii, part of the Banksia Woodlands ecological community on the Swan Coastal Plain of Western Australia that is listed as under threat and in serious decline, by the Australian Government Ministry for Environment and Energy.
